OSCP: Your Path To Ethical Hacking Mastery
What's up, cybersecurity enthusiasts! Ever heard of the OSCP certification? If you're even remotely interested in penetration testing and ethical hacking, you've probably stumbled across this gem. The Offensive Security Certified Professional (OSCP) certification is, hands down, one of the most respected and sought-after certs in the industry. It's not just a piece of paper; it's a testament to your ability to actually do the work. We're talking about a hands-on exam that throws you into a virtual lab environment, requiring you to compromise various machines and systems. Itβs the real deal, guys, and getting it can seriously boost your career trajectory. Think of it as your golden ticket to proving you've got the skills to think like an attacker and defend like a pro.
Why the OSCP is a Big Deal
So, why all the hype around the OSCP? Well, it's pretty simple. Unlike many other certifications that rely on multiple-choice questions and theoretical knowledge, the OSCP is all about practical application. The exam is notorious for its difficulty, but that's exactly why it carries so much weight. When you pass the OSCP, you're not just saying you know about penetration testing; you're proving you can perform it. You'll learn to exploit vulnerabilities, escalate privileges, and navigate complex networks β skills that are absolutely critical for any aspiring penetration tester. Employers love this. They know that an OSCP holder has been through the trenches, has demonstrated resilience under pressure, and possesses the genuine ability to find and exploit security weaknesses. It's a badge of honor that speaks volumes about your dedication and technical prowess. Plus, the learning journey itself is incredibly rewarding. You'll dive deep into tools and techniques that are used daily by offensive security professionals, building a solid foundation for a successful career in cybersecurity.
Getting Started with Your OSCP Journey
Alright, so you're pumped and ready to tackle the OSCP. Awesome! The first step is diving into the Official Penetration Testing with Kali Linux (PWK) course. This is the official training material from Offensive Security, and it's your bible for the OSCP. The course is delivered online and comes with access to a virtual lab environment where you can practice the skills you learn. Seriously, guys, lab time is non-negotiable. The more you practice, the better you'll become. The PWK course covers a wide range of topics, from basic network scanning and enumeration to more advanced exploitation techniques, buffer overflows, and privilege escalation. It's designed to be challenging, pushing you to learn and adapt. Don't expect to breeze through it; expect to put in the work. The course provides the foundational knowledge, but your real learning will happen as you actively engage with the lab machines. Think of it as a puzzle; each machine is a different challenge, and figuring out how to crack it is where the magic happens. Remember, the OSCP isn't about memorizing facts; it's about developing a problem-solving mindset and a deep understanding of how systems can be compromised.
The PWK Course and Lab Environment
Let's talk more about the PWK course and the lab environment. The course itself is a treasure trove of information. It's structured to guide you through the fundamental concepts and techniques of penetration testing. You'll learn about reconnaissance, vulnerability analysis, exploitation, post-exploitation, and even some basic web application security. But here's the kicker: the PWK course is just the introduction. The real learning, the kind that gets you ready for the OSCP exam, happens in the lab. Offensive Security provides a massive virtual lab network filled with machines of varying difficulty. Your mission, should you choose to accept it, is to compromise as many of these machines as possible. Each machine is a unique challenge, designed to test specific skills. You'll be using Kali Linux, a distribution packed with all the tools you'll ever need for penetration testing. Getting comfortable with tools like Nmap, Metasploit, Burp Suite, and many others is crucial. The labs are your playground, your training ground, and your proving ground. You'll face setbacks, you'll get stuck, but you'll also experience those 'aha!' moments when you finally crack a machine. Embrace the struggle, guys; it's what makes the eventual success so much sweeter. The more time you invest in the labs, the more confident you'll feel walking into the exam.
Preparing for the OSCP Exam
Now, let's get down to the nitty-gritty: preparing for the OSCP exam. This is where all your hard work in the PWK course and labs pays off. The exam itself is a grueling 24-hour practical test. You'll be given access to a separate network of machines, and you'll need to compromise as many as possible within the time limit. But that's not all! After the 24-hour exam, you have an additional 24 hours to submit a detailed report outlining your findings and the steps you took to compromise each machine. This means you need to be both a skilled attacker and a meticulous documenter. Time management during the exam is absolutely critical. You can't afford to get stuck on one machine for hours. Learn to pivot, know when to move on, and understand how to prioritize your targets. Many candidates recommend trying to get 'user' flags on as many machines as possible, and then focusing on 'root' flags on fewer machines. Building a strong understanding of privilege escalation techniques is paramount. Remember, the exam environment is different from the labs, so don't get too comfortable. Practice under timed conditions, simulate the exam environment as much as possible, and learn to troubleshoot on the fly. The OSCP is a marathon, not a sprint, so stay persistent, stay focused, and keep learning.
The OSCP Exam Experience
Let's talk about the actual OSCP exam experience. Guys, it's intense. Picture this: 24 hours, a virtual lab full of systems you need to hack, and the pressure is on. You'll be given a set of IP addresses, and your goal is to gain unauthorized access to as many of them as possible. This isn't a theoretical test; it's a live-fire exercise. You'll be performing reconnaissance, identifying vulnerabilities, crafting exploits, and escalating privileges, all in real-time. The exam is designed to mirror real-world penetration testing scenarios, so you'll need to be adaptable and resourceful. Don't expect a walk in the park; the machines are challenging, and sometimes you'll hit a wall. That's when your problem-solving skills and persistence really come into play. Remember those late nights in the PWK labs? They were preparing you for moments like these. It's crucial to have a solid understanding of common attack vectors and a deep knowledge of the tools you'll be using. Many successful candidates emphasize the importance of documenting everything as you go. Even if you don't manage to compromise a machine completely, showing your thought process and the steps you took can sometimes earn you partial points. The stress can be immense, but try to stay calm, focused, and methodical. Remember, you've trained for this!
Reporting Your OSCP Findings
Beyond just hacking into machines, the OSCP exam requires a detailed report. This is often overlooked by aspiring pentesters, but it's a crucial part of the certification. After the 24-hour hacking phase, you have another 24 hours to compile and submit a comprehensive report. This report needs to clearly outline your methodology, the vulnerabilities you discovered, the exploits you used, and how you escalated privileges. Think of it as presenting your case to a client. You need to be clear, concise, and technically accurate. Good documentation is a skill in itself, and the OSCP exam tests this. Include screenshots, commands, and detailed explanations for each step of your penetration test. A well-written report demonstrates not only your technical abilities but also your professionalism and communication skills. It shows that you can translate complex technical findings into actionable intelligence. Many candidates suggest keeping a running log during the exam itself to make report writing easier. Don't underestimate the importance of this part; it's a significant chunk of your overall score. A flawless technical compromise can be undermined by a poorly written report, so make sure you allocate sufficient time and effort to this crucial deliverable. Guys, this is your chance to shine and prove you can do more than just break in; you can explain how you did it and why it matters.
Post-OSCP: What's Next?
So, you've conquered the OSCP! Congratulations! That's a massive achievement, and you should be incredibly proud. But what's next? The OSCP opens a lot of doors in the cybersecurity industry. Many companies specifically look for OSCP-certified professionals for roles like penetration tester, security consultant, and even security engineer. Your resume just got a whole lot more impressive. Beyond job opportunities, the OSCP is a fantastic stepping stone for further specialization. You might want to pursue more advanced certifications like the OSCE (Offensive Security Certified Expert) or delve into specific areas like web application security or exploit development. The skills you gained during your OSCP journey β critical thinking, problem-solving, persistence, and hands-on technical expertise β are transferable to countless other fields. The learning never stops in cybersecurity, and the OSCP certification is just the beginning of a continuous learning process. Keep honing your skills, stay curious, and always be ready to adapt to the ever-evolving threat landscape. You've proven you have what it takes to succeed in one of the toughest certifications out there; now go out there and make a difference!